Living Room, Den and Primary Bedroom have motorized sunshades.860-870 United Nations Plaza also known as 'The UN Plaza' is a cooperative composed of two 38- story towers with a total of 336 apartments (of which 56 are duplexes on the top eight floors.) The building features a fully equipped fitness center, garage, bicycle parking, storage cage for each apartment and magnificent sundecks bestowed with 360 degree views of Manhattan and beyond. Both buildings are children and dog-friendly with a massive support staff. One rare detail of the property is a private full-block circular driveway at the 49th Street exit of the FDR Drive. Location of the towers are convenient to Grand Central, buses, subways, FDR, Wall Street, theater district, epicurean restaurants, shopping, Long Island, Queens, Brooklyn.860-870 United Nations Plaza is one of New York City's modernist classic residential building in the heart of Midtown Manhattan. In 1966, both buildings were built by master architects Wallace Harrison & Max Abramovitz who served as the lead architects for the United Nations Headquarters complex and other iconic buildings such as Time-Life Building at Rockefeller Center.
